The Nike Air Force 1, a silhouette that transcends generations and trends, remains a cornerstone of sneaker culture. Its clean lines, comfortable cushioning, and endless customization options have cemented its place as a timeless classic. While available in a myriad of colors, the Nike Air Force 1 Blauw (Dutch for blue) holds a special place, offering a versatile palette ranging from subtle sky blues to vibrant royal hues. This exploration delves into the various shades, styles, and the enduring appeal of the blue Nike Air Force 1, considering its history, its place in contemporary fashion, and where to find the perfect pair.

A Legacy of Blue: Tracing the History of Blue Air Force 1s

The Air Force 1's initial release in 1982 wasn't primarily focused on a specific colorway. However, as the shoe's popularity exploded, Nike began experimenting with a wider range of colors, including various shades of blue. Early iterations likely featured blues as part of broader color schemes, perhaps accenting white or black uppers. The evolution towards dedicated blue Air Force 1s was gradual, mirroring the growing demand for customizable and expressive footwear.

The rise of the sneakerhead culture in the late 1990s and early 2000s significantly fueled the popularity of specific colorways, including various blue variations. This period saw increased collaborations, limited editions, and a greater focus on unique color palettes. Blue, with its versatility and association with both calm and power, became a sought-after option. Certain blue Air Force 1s released during this time have since become highly collectible, commanding significant prices in the secondary market.

Navigating the Shades of Blue: From Light to Dark

The spectrum of blue Air Force 1s is surprisingly broad. From the calming pastels of baby blue and powder blue to the deep, rich tones of navy and midnight blue, the options are almost limitless. Understanding these variations is crucial for finding the perfect pair to complement your personal style.

* Light Blues: These shades, including baby blue, powder blue, and light sky blue, often evoke a sense of serenity and freshness. They pair well with lighter clothing and are ideal for a casual, summery look. These lighter blues are often seen on low-top Air Force 1s, giving them a more youthful and playful feel.

* Medium Blues: This category encompasses a wider range, including shades like royal blue, cornflower blue, and periwinkle. These colors offer a balance between vibrancy and subtlety. Royal blue, in particular, is a popular choice, offering a bold statement without being overly aggressive. Medium blues work well with a variety of outfits, from jeans and a t-shirt to more formal attire.

* Dark Blues: Navy blue and midnight blue represent the darker end of the spectrum. These deeper tones often project a more sophisticated and mature aesthetic. They are versatile and can be dressed up or down, making them a staple in many wardrobes. The darker shades tend to be more durable and less prone to showing dirt, a practical advantage for daily wear.
